Mamunul among 43 sued for Tk 20cr misappropriation
Hefajat-e-Islam's former secretary general Mamunul Haque among 43 people has been sued for misappropriating Tk 20 crore.
Among the accused, 24 are religious speakers.
Maulana Abdur Razzak Kasemi, director of Al Madrasatu Mueenul Islam, filed a case with the court of Dhaka Metropolitan Magistrate Morshed Al Mamun Bhuiyan on Tuesday, court sources said.

After hearing, the magistrate took the case into cognisance and recorded the complainant's statements on Tuesday.
The court also directed Police Bureau of Investigation (PBI) to investigate the case and submit a report to it by July 17.
According to case documents, on October last year, around 250 people, led by 33 of the accused, illegally gathered near Al Madrasatu Mueenul Islam in the capital. At one stage, they stormed into the madrasa and looted cash and valuable documents.
On October 13 that year, the accused attacked teachers of the madrasa and some guardians with iron rods, sticks, sharp weapons and bamboo, and snatched away their money and phones, the complainant said.
